Overview

Heavy Civil/Industrial Project Manager - Water/Wastewater for a Phoenix-based water and wastewater treatment plant construction team. This role offers the opportunity to oversee and manage complex water and wastewater projects and work with a diverse team in the construction industry.

Responsibilities
  • Oversee and manage all aspects of water and wastewater and pump station construction projects from initiation to completion, ensuring projects are completed on time, within budget, and to high quality standards.
  • Lead and coordinate a team of engineers, contractors, and other professionals during all phases of project development and execution.
  • Prepare, review, and update project plans, schedules, and budgets, ensuring alignment with these plans.
  • Coordinate and supervise the construction process from conceptual development through final construction, ensuring work follows design specifications.
  • Manage and resolve issues that arise during the project; document and communicate changes to all relevant parties.
  • Ensure compliance with local, state, and federal regulations and safety standards related to water and wastewater construction projects.
  • Build and maintain relationships with clients, subcontractors, suppliers, and other stakeholders; keep parties informed of progress and changes.
Qualifications
  • Minimum of 5 years of experience in project management, specifically in heavy civil/industrial construction.
  • Proven experience managing water and wastewater construction projects, including underground utilities, pump stations, site work, structural concrete; knowledge of process piping, mechanical piping, and yard piping is a plus.
  • Strong leadership and team management skills; ability to coordinate and oversee a professional team.
  • Excellent problem-solving abilities to identify and resolve project issues effectively.
  • Strong communication and interpersonal skills to build and maintain relationships with clients, subcontractors, suppliers, and other stakeholders.
  • Understanding of local, state, and federal regulations and safety standards related to water and wastewater construction.
  • Proficiency in project management software and related applications.
  • A degree in Civil Engineering, Construction Management, or a related field is preferred.
